HOME
NEWS
Latest News
Features
Analyses
Great Goals Project
Job Security
Season Reviews
LIVE SCORES
Live Scores
Thursday
Yesterday (Friday)
Today
(Saturday)
Tomorrow (Sunday)
Monday
Tuesday
Wednesday
Most Exciting Matches
Best Performing Players
COMPETITIONS
Premier League
La Liga
Serie A
Bundesliga
Ligue 1
Eredivisie
UEFA Champions League
UEFA Europa League
All competitions..
TEAMS
Man Utd
Liverpool
Man City
Arsenal
Chelsea
Tottenham
Barcelona
Real Madrid
Bayern
Juventus
PSG
PLAYERS
Top 50 Best Players
Overall
Overall Rising
Goalkeepers
Defenders
(Full) Backs
Central Midfielders
Attacking Midfielders
Attacking Midfielders Left/Right
Attackers
Golden Boys
Golden Boys Rising
Veterans
Golden Boys
Golden Boys Top 50
Golden Boys Rising
Phil Foden
Matthijs de Ligt
Frenkie de Jong
Houssem Aouar
Jadon Sancho
Kai Havertz
Gianluigi Donnarumma
Declan Rice
Vinícius Júnior
Martin Odegaard
BETTING
ABOUT US
FAQs
Colophon
Contact
Privacy Policy
Terms Of Use
Recommended Sites
Data Sports Group
Welcome
Guest
Profile
Notifications
Thank you for using Footballcritic.
Start by talking about your audience, not yourself.
Logout
x
FootballCritic
Scotland
Premier League
2024/2025
Rangers - St Johnstone
Match Report
Rangers
RAN
Černý
(34', 58')
2 - 0
-
Full Time
St Johnstone
JOH
Preview
Lineups
Report
Match stats
Player ratings
Rangers vs St Johnstone Live Updates and Match Report
All events
Rangers has won the match.
Player IN
Substitute in,
Fran Franczak
.
Player OUT
Substitute out,
Aaron Essel
.
Player IN
Substitute in,
Dujon Sterling
.
Player OUT
Substitute out,
Nedim Bajrami
.
84'
Red card!
Red card for
Ianis Hagi
.
81'
Player IN
Substitute in,
David Keltjens
.
Player IN
Substitute in,
Graham Carey
.
Player OUT
Substitute out,
André Raymond
.
Player OUT
Substitute out,
Makenzie Kirk
.
74'
Player IN
Substitute in,
Neraysho Kasanwirjo
.
Player OUT
Substitute out,
Václav Černý
.
73'
Yellow card
Yellow card for
Nicolas Raskin
.
63'
Player IN
Substitute in,
Hamza Igamane
.
Player OUT
Substitute out,
Cyriel Dessers
.
60'
Assist
Assist given by
Ianis Hagi
.
GOAL!!! 2-0
Goal by
Václav Černý
.
58'
Player IN
Substitute in,
Cameron MacPherson
.
Player IN
Substitute in,
Adama Sidibeh
.
Player OUT
Substitute out,
Sven Sprangler
.
Player OUT
Substitute out,
Drey Wright
.
Player IN
Substitute in,
Ianis Hagi
.
Player IN
Substitute in,
Connor Barron
.
Player OUT
Substitute out,
Ross McCausland
.
Player OUT
Substitute out,
Mohamed Diomandé
.
46'
Assist
Assist given by
Mohamed Diomandé
.
GOAL!!! 1-0
Goal by
Václav Černý
.
34'
Yellow card
Yellow card for
Aaron Essel
.
22'
Do Not Sell My Personal Information
Substitute in, Fran Franczak.
Substitute out, Aaron Essel.
Substitute in, Dujon Sterling.
Substitute out, Nedim Bajrami.
Red card for Ianis Hagi.
Substitute in, David Keltjens.
Substitute in, Graham Carey.
Substitute out, André Raymond.
Substitute out, Makenzie Kirk.
Substitute in, Neraysho Kasanwirjo.
Substitute out, Václav Černý.
Yellow card for Nicolas Raskin.
Substitute in, Hamza Igamane.
Substitute out, Cyriel Dessers.
Assist given by Ianis Hagi.
Goal by Václav Černý.
Substitute in, Cameron MacPherson.
Substitute in, Adama Sidibeh.
Substitute out, Sven Sprangler.
Substitute out, Drey Wright .
Substitute in, Ianis Hagi.
Substitute in, Connor Barron.
Substitute out, Ross McCausland.
Substitute out, Mohamed Diomandé.
Assist given by Mohamed Diomandé.
Goal by Václav Černý.
Yellow card for Aaron Essel.